也不知道这个问题难不难,如何屏蔽鼠标滚轮事件?浏览器里默认的滚轮事件是网页垂直下滚,我需要用滚轮事件做其他的事情,不知道如何屏蔽它。我如果想让鼠标滚轮控制水平滚动,该怎么做,麻烦给个代码,先谢谢了。
解决方案 »
- 一个焦点图(就是网站图片轮换的),怎么把鼠标事件由点击改为滑过。(内附原代码)
- js设置cookie问题,我做网易登陆器遇到的疑问
- 如何只显示一个showModelessDialog页面
- 有人用过rialto吗?
- javascript里如何回车后就点击button按纽
- 关于表格◎◎!!!!!!!!!!
- 怪问题,难倒好多人了,高手来看看(在ASP版块)
- js文件在frame中的应用问题。搞定就给分。
- 两个简单问题:open()方法怎样指定打开页面的目标框架(frmae)?怎样在单击frmMain中某页面按钮时使框架frmMain的scrolling为"NO"?
- 如何实现如sleep(3000),停止工作3秒的函数?
- 大家帮帮忙,我想了好久了
- 有关js改变字体大小的问题……
IE可以。
1.屏蔽网页垂直下滚:
document.body.onmousewheel = function(){return false;}
2、用滚轮做其他事情,
element.onmousewheel = function(){do your work here};
滚轮事件的event有一个event.wheelDelta属性。上滚一次,返回120,下滚一次返回-120;
因为不知道你的具体需求,具体的就你自己实现吧。
祝你好运。
mousewheel
ff
DOMMouseScroll